Output efec8fab5bceda51cc82687f58df10562f31207c2c6106e5d84d8fd2b6dbbfb0:1

value
68834966
script pubkey
OP_0 OP_PUSHBYTES_20 6f67cc10e49d16c4ab5814c0b478537ef0ba7a7c
address
bc1qdanucy8yn5tvf26cznqtg7zn0mct57nunqnsyw
transaction
efec8fab5bceda51cc82687f58df10562f31207c2c6106e5d84d8fd2b6dbbfb0
confirmations
146047
spent
true